Output de776cc357bbf19815c0c172515060093777efc6c7c55e081ccdad4df254f87a:92

value
956583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c6832f3ad02cfe371e3e196bd54d40b725749b9 OP_EQUAL
address
3A7cv4t6NSZzPgWp6BWK8nKGPP1E49cCrQ
transaction
de776cc357bbf19815c0c172515060093777efc6c7c55e081ccdad4df254f87a
confirmations
177645
spent
true